And to-night I wanted to show you--to--to share it with you.

You hated the piano--you wanted to smash it, because you thought it came between us.
And so I tried to make you understand!" Her words came rushing out headlong now, bitter, sobbing words, holding all the agony of mind which she had been enduring for so long.
"You've no idea what music means to me--and you've not tried to find out.

Instead, you've laughed indulgently about it, been impatient over it, and behaved as though it were some child's toy of which you didn't quite approve." Her voice shook.

"And it isn't! It's _part_ of me--part of the woman you want to marry.
